How AI Recommendation Systems Work

AI recommendation systems generally work by analyzing available information and estimating which products may be relevant to a particular shopper or situation.

A simplified recommendation process can look like this:

  1. The system collects available shopping and product information.
  2. The system identifies patterns and relationships in that information.
  3. The system evaluates products that could be relevant.
  4. The system ranks potential recommendations.
  5. The shopping platform displays selected recommendations.
  6. The system may learn from subsequent interactions.

The process can involve very large datasets.

For example, an e-commerce platform may have information about millions of products and many different shopping interactions. AI can help process these relationships much faster than a person could manually.

The recommendation does not necessarily mean that a product is objectively the best choice.

It means the system has identified the product as potentially relevant based on the information and signals available to it.

This distinction is important when evaluating personalized recommendations.

How AI Finds Similar Products

AI recommendation systems can identify products that share certain characteristics.

These characteristics can include product category, brand, specifications, materials, size, functionality, or other attributes.

Suppose a shopper views a particular backpack.

A recommendation system might identify other backpacks with similar characteristics.

It could also identify products that appeal to shoppers who viewed or purchased the same backpack.

These are two different approaches.

Product similarity

Product similarity focuses on characteristics shared by the products themselves.

Behavioral similarity

Behavioral similarity focuses on what shoppers tend to do when interacting with those products.

AI systems can combine multiple approaches to create recommendations.

This can help explain why a recommendation sometimes looks different from the original product while still being considered relevant by the system.

What Does “Frequently Bought Together” Mean?

“Frequently Bought Together” is a common type of recommendation based on relationships between products.

The underlying idea is that certain products are often purchased during the same shopping journey.

For example, consumers buying a particular type of electronic device may also purchase a compatible accessory.

A shopping platform can analyze purchase patterns and identify products that frequently appear together.

This information can then be used to suggest related items to future shoppers.

The recommendation is based on observed shopping patterns rather than a guarantee that the products are necessary for every consumer.

Consumers should therefore determine whether a suggested product actually serves a purpose before adding it to an order.

How Recommendations Work for New Shoppers

Recommendation systems face a challenge when a shopper has little or no previous activity.

This situation is sometimes referred to as a “cold start” problem.

Without a history of searches, views, or purchases, the system has fewer personalized signals to work with.

New shoppers may therefore receive recommendations based on broader information.

These recommendations could be influenced by:

  • Popular products
  • Current product trends
  • Category-level information
  • Products similar to the item currently being viewed
  • General shopping patterns

As the shopper interacts with the website, the system may have more information to use for personalization.

Consequently, recommendations can become more specific as a consumer searches, views, saves, or purchases products.

Limitations of AI Product Recommendations

AI recommendations can be useful, but they are not perfect predictions of what a consumer should purchase.

One limitation is incomplete information.

An AI system may not know why a shopper viewed a particular product or whether a previous purchase was intended for personal use.

Another limitation is changing consumer preferences.

People’s needs can change over time, while recommendation systems may continue to use historical signals.

Recommendations can also be affected by product availability.

A system may identify a relevant product, but that product could become unavailable or change in price.

Other limitations include:

  • Incorrect product data
  • Outdated information
  • Irrelevant recommendations
  • Overreliance on past behavior
  • Incomplete understanding of personal preferences
  • Difficulty interpreting unusual shopping needs

For consumers, the practical lesson is simple: a recommendation is a suggestion, not a requirement.
